Objectives of the Course

The aim of this course is to teach basic optical concepts and to comprehend the physical basis of the interaction of light with matter.

Course Content

Classification of optical processes, Classical propagation, Interband absorption, Excitons, Luminescence, Quantum confinement, Quantum dots, Free electrons, Molecular materials, Luminescence centres, Phonons, Nonlinear optics
